Pro Choice Campaigners are taking to the streets of Dublin city today calling for changes to abortion laws here.
The 4th Annual March for Choice is being organised by the Abortion Rights Campaign.
Organisers of the demonstration are asking participants to bring wheelie suitcases with them, to highlight the number of women who travel abroad from Ireland to access terminations.
The march starts at the Garden of Remembrance at 2pm this afternoon.
